**Step 1: Prepare the Oat Mixture**
Start by lining an 8×8-inch square baking pan with parchment paper or lightly greasing it. This will help you easily remove the bars once they’ve set.
In a large bowl, combine the **rolled oats**, **peanut butter**, **honey**, **vanilla extract**, and **salt** (if using). Stir until everything is well combined, and you have a thick, sticky mixture. You’ll want to make sure all the oats are coated with the peanut butter and honey.
**Step 3: Melt the Chocolate**
In a small microwave-safe bowl, combine the **chocolate chips** and **coconut oil**. Microwave in 30-second intervals, stirring in between, until the chocolate is completely melted and smooth. You can also melt the chocolate over a double boiler if you prefer.
**Step 4: Pour the Chocolate Over the Oat Base**
Once the chocolate is melted, pour it evenly over the pressed oat mixture. Use a spatula to spread the chocolate out, covering the entire surface of the bars. The glossy chocolate layer will harden nicely in the fridge, giving your bars a smooth, rich finish.
**Step 6: Slice and Enjoy!**
Once the bars are firm, remove the pan from the fridge and lift the bars out using the parchment paper. Place the bars on a cutting board and slice them into squares or rectangles, depending on your preference.
– **Use Old-Fashioned Rolled Oats**: Old-fashioned oats provide the best texture for these bars. Quick oats may not give you the same chewy consistency, and steel-cut oats can be too coarse.
– **Add-ins for Extra Flavor**: Feel free to customize these bars with your favorite add-ins. Some great options include:
– Chopped nuts (walnuts, almonds, or pecans)
– Dried fruit (raisins, cranberries, or cherries)
– Shredded coconut
– A sprinkle of sea salt on top for that sweet-salty flavor
– **Storage**: Store the bars in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. If you want them to last longer, keep them in the refrigerator for up to 2 weeks, or freeze them for up to 3 months.
